SARS Career Opportunities Ops Specialist Learning Design & Development Job Description
Job Purpose
To provide expertise, advice and support to develop operational implementation plans and / or associated service delivery processes, by designing and developing curriculum and learning programmes so that the training needs identified in the skills development strategies can be met, in order to continuously enhance service delivery.
Outputs
- Conduct training needs analysis in order to ascertain and advise on the best possible resolution to identified skills gaps.
- Design, develop, organise, execute and evaluate training to address identified needs
- Determine the type of curriculum, learning methodology and learning programme that is required and liaise with subject matter experts to obtain the information required to be included in the learning programme
- Design and develop the learning programme/s so that the learning outcomes will be achieved within the selected learning methodology
- Discuss the draft learning programme/s with the subject matter experts and learning solutions architects as well as the training facilitators and make amendments as required
- Ensure that the learning programme includes effective assessment techniques and subscribes to the principles of adult learning
- Conduct Training of Trainers on newly developed content to enable trainers/facilititators to effectively deliver the training
- Attend the pilot training course to assess the learning programme and make amendments as required and evaluate the effectiveness of the learning programme and its impact on the business of SARS.
